Paramount+ is expanding its reach in Asia as it announces its launch in Japan through partnerships with J:COM and Wowow. The popular streaming service will be available as a free addition to J:COM’s cable and internet platform, as well as to Wowow’s pay-TV service.

The launch in Japan marks the second country in East Asia where Paramount+ becomes available, following its successful debut in South Korea in June last year. In South Korea, Paramount+ operates as a free tier on the local streaming platform TVing, thanks to the strategic partnership between Paramount and leading Korean entertainment group CJ ENM. Paramount+ also operates through partnerships with SKY in Italy, the U.K., and Germany, as well as with Canal+ in France.

Japanese viewers can look forward to enjoying Paramount+ originals such as “Tulsa King,” “Mayor of Kingstown,” and “Star Trek: Strange New Worlds” when the service launches. This will be the first time these highly anticipated shows are available in Japan.

Paramount expressed excitement about the partnership with J:COM and Wowow, emphasizing the milestone it represents for the streaming business. Marco Nobili, Executive VP and International GM of Paramount+ International, said, “I am excited to strengthen our collaboration with J:COM and Wowow to offer their audiences incredible content and beloved stars and characters from our iconic studios and brands.”

Both J:COM and Wowow have previously enjoyed a successful relationship with Paramount through the delivery of MTV music channel and a variety of movies and dramas. Iwaki Yoichi, President and Representative Director of J:COM, stated, “We are pleased to bring Paramount’s diverse content to the people of Japan through this new partnership,” adding that Paramount+ original productions like “NCIS” and “CSI” are highly acclaimed by their customers.

Similarly, Tanaka Akira, Representative Director, President, and CEO of Wowow, expressed enthusiasm for the partnership, highlighting their satisfaction with the Hollywood films and drama series they have received from Paramount Global over the past 20 years. With the new collaboration, Wowow will now offer a large volume of wonderful content from Paramount+, including films and international dramas, through its on-demand service.
